What are death claims?

A death claims or wrongful death claim are brought by the surviving family. There are specific laws governing these types of cases. A family member or person in charge of the deceased’s estate generally files a suit to recover all damages associated with the wrongful death.

Damages in death claims

Wrongful death cases generally involve two main categories:

  • The first category covers damages prior to the deceased’s death. Some common damages in this category include medical costs, lost income, and burial expenses.
  • The second category covers damages used to compensate for the surviving family. In other words, how much monetary support the family is missing due to their loved one’s death.
  • Pain and suffering – These damages are also available in California. This category allows husbands and wives to recover from the loss of companionship.

Who is entitled to collect compensation?

In order to determine who is entitled to receive compensation in wrongful death claims, the court will consider a few factors such as the relationship the surviving family had with the deceased. Whether that includes children, a spouse, or a parent, these parties can be awarded damages in death claims. In some cases, punitive damages may also be awarded, if the defendant engaged in disorderly conduct. The defendant will be punished so that other potential victims are protected from this type of behavior.
